Jobs with Justice is a national campaign for workers' rights. JwJ's mission is to improve working people's standard of living, fight for job security, and protect workers' right to organize. JwJ's core belief is that in order to be successful, workers' rights struggles have to be part of a larger campaign for economic and social justice. To that end, JwJ has created a network of over 40 local coalitions that connect labor, faith-based, community, and student organizations to work together on workplace, community and social justice campaigns.  To learn more, visit the Jobs with Justice website at www.jwj.org
